"erti" meaning in Javanese

See erti in All languages combined, or Wiktionary

Verb

IPA: /ərˈti/ Forms: spelling ꦲꦼꦂꦠꦶ [Carakan], ngerti [active]
Etymology: Inherited from Old Javanese arthi (“meaning, explanation”), from artha (“aim, purpose; material progress; wealth, possessions; money; sense, meaning”), from Sanskrit अर्थ (artha, “meaning, wealth”). Doublet of ꦲꦂꦠꦶ (arti).   1. to understand
